Construction work on development project kicks off in Maidan Wardak

MAIDAN SHAHR: Construction work on a retaining wall worth $100,000 has been kicked off in Maidan Wardak province, the governor’s press office said in a statement today.

The project, with the financial support of the United Nations Food and Agriculture Organization (FAO), will be built in Deh Hayat village, Nirkh district of Maidan Wardak province.

The retaining wall, with 170 meters long and 4 meters wide, will be constructed within three months, said the statement, adding the aim behind the construction of the wall is to prevent flooding and protect public and private assets from the dangers posed by flash floods.
